Manufacturing Engineer
Position Scope/Summary:
The Manufacturing / Process Engineering Leader provides technical leadership across manufacturing systems, process validation, optimization, and continuous improvement initiatives. This role spans applied engineering execution through strategic, multi-site leadership, with increasing responsibility for design governance, Six Sigma deployment, risk ownership, and business impact. The position serves as both a hands-on problem solver and strategic technical authority, influencing outcomes across areas, sites, and the enterprise.
Position Requirements:
Engineering Design, Standards & Technical Execution
- Develops manufacturing drawings, fixtures, tooling, and equipment designs, progressing to design approval authority, best-practice definition, and governance
- Applies and leads Six Sigma methodologies (Green Belt through Black Belt mastery), including coaching and enterprise deployment
- Supports, leads, and defines process validation activities (IQ/OQ and beyond), scaling to enterprise validation strategy ownership
- Drives process optimization from lean methods and throughput improvements to strategic, enterprise-wide gains
- Leads small to medium engineering projects and validation efforts
- Progresses to managing complex projects, large programs, and capital initiatives
- Owns portions of VIP initiatives, advances to capital planning and portfolio-level ownership
- Aligns technical programs with business strategy, capacity, and investment planning
- Participates in, leads, and governs RCA activities from defined issues to systemic, multi-site investigations
- Resolves increasingly complex, ambiguous, and cross-functional problems
- Establishes escalation paths, best practices, and enterprise RCA standards
- Applies structured problem-solving to deliver durable, scalable solutions

- Manufacturing, production, and industrial environments with a blend of office and floor presence
- Regular interaction with operating equipment, tooling, and production systems
- Periods of extended standing, walking, or on-floor support
- Occasional travel for site or multi-site responsibilities
- Use of appropriate PPE and adherence to all safety and regulatory requirements
- Bachelor’s degree in Engineering required; Master’s degree preferred for senior and enterprise roles
- Progressive experience in manufacturing, process engineering, or industrial operations
- Demonstrated expertise in Six Sigma, validation, process optimization, and capital project execution
- Proven ability to lead cross-functional initiatives and influence without authority
